Sri Thirumalai Kumara Swami Temple is a hilltop Temple located in Panpozhi which is close to Tenkasi. There is a Welcome Arch at the foot hill of the Temple where the ghat road and the foot steps begin. The Temple authorities charge Rs.50/- for all four wheelers using the ghat road to reach the Temple. There is a huge car parking atop the Temple premises. It is said that long ago The Priest of Thirumalai Kaali Amman Temple had a dream in which it said that a Murugan or Kumaraswamy Idol is buried under a Bamboo bush. It is said that the King of Pandalam heard this story and took the Priest to find out the Bamboo bush. The duo found an army of Ants heading towards a particular place and when they dug out and excavated they found out the Presiding Deity of Thirumalai Kumara Swami. Hence they brought it out and installed it here with great reverance. There is a pillared Welcome Arch leading to the Temple and the first Sub Shrine is that of the Uchi Pillayar who is East facing. Devotees may have to climb 15 to 20 steps to view the Ucchi Pillayar. Beneath a Arasa Maram there is a Sub Shrine for Thiruppani Vinayagar. There is a South facing entrance with a Gopuram and there are coloured Idols placed on top of this Gopuram. Devotees may have to climb a few steps to the reach the multi pillared Moolasthanam. There are two Dwara Baalagas standing guard here. There is a huge Dwajasthambam or a Flag Staff, a Neivedhya Peedam along with a Mayil Vaahanam or a Peacock facing the Sanctum Sanctorum. In the East facing Moolasthanam Arulmigu Thirumalai Kumara Swami could be seen in a standing posture with four hands. Just outside the Moolasthanam is the Urchavamoorthy Idol. In the inner peripheral there is a South facing Bhairavar who is seen in a standing posture. Likewise Kanni Vinayagar and a Sastha along with Naga Devathas Sub Shrine is also seen here. Thee are various options to see the Presiding Deity. Devotees can have a free darshan and view Thirumalai Kumaraswamy from a distance. Otherwise they can pay Rs.20/- or Rs.100/- and such Devotees are allowed to have a closer glimpse of the Presiding Deity. The Temple has facilities to draw a Golden Chariot for which they have to pay a sum of Rs.1,200/-.  6 Karthigai Pengal viz. Thula, Amba, Varthyenthi, Megenthi, Amaragenthi and Nitharthani's Idols are embossed on the walls of the Temple. Circumambulating the Temple is a great experience and the surrounding ambience simply thrills the Devotees, especially Kids. Facing one of the Gopurams here are two staircases and on either side of them two huge balck peacocks have been etched. This is truly eye captivating and a many Devotees take a snap of it to preserve the scene for posterity. There is a North facing Thirumalai Kaliamman Sub Shrine. The Sthala Viruksham of this Temple is a Puliya Maram or a Tamarind Tree and a Murugan Idol along with a few Naga Devathas are kept beneath it and neatly fenced. The Temple has a very modern Pushkarani named as Poonjunai and the Saptha Kannigaigal are kept close to it. There is a Temple Office and a Temple Library functioning at the hilltop. They have an Annadhana Koodam for the sake of the Devotees. There is a shop which sells Divine Pooja Articles, Toys, Souvenirs and Prasadams. The Temple offer facilities for Tonsuring and not only Kids but several elders too get their head tonsured and remove their hair. This Temple is considered as a Nakshthra Temple for those born under the Visaka Star.  Thai Poosam, Skanda Shasti, Aadi Kiruthigai, Thiru Karthigai, Vaikasi Visakam are some of the festivals celebrated with great fanfare.
